This article explores innovative strategies and solutions to enhance energy efficiency in residential homes, focusing on key areas and services that contribute to overall energy improvement.
Improving residential energy efficiency often starts with identifying areas where energy loss is most common. Gaps around windows and doors, insufficient insulation, and aging building materials can all contribute to higher energy use. Addressing these issues helps create a more stable indoor environment while reducing unnecessary strain on heating and cooling systems.
Modern heating and cooling upgrades also play a major role in overall energy improvement. High-efficiency HVAC systems, programmable thermostats, and regular maintenance allow homeowners to better control indoor temperatures. These upgrades support consistent comfort throughout the year while helping manage monthly energy costs.
Lighting and appliance choices further influence a home’s energy performance. Switching to LED lighting and ENERGY STAR–rated appliances reduces electricity consumption without sacrificing functionality. Over time, these small changes can collectively make a noticeable difference in household energy use.
Building envelope improvements, such as improved insulation and reflective roofing materials, help regulate indoor temperatures more effectively. By limiting heat transfer, homes stay cooler in warmer months and retain warmth during colder seasons. These improvements also support longer-lasting building components and reduced wear on mechanical systems.
Finally, adopting energy-efficient habits reinforces the benefits of physical upgrades. Simple actions like adjusting thermostat settings, sealing unused vents, and scheduling routine system checkups help maintain efficiency long term. When combined with strategic home improvements, these practices contribute to a more sustainable and comfortable living space.

2.1 Understanding Energy-Efficient Windows
Energy-efficient windows are designed to minimize heat loss in winter and reduce heat gain in summer. These windows often feature double or triple-pane glass with specialized coatings that improve insulation. By choosing such windows, homeowners can maintain a consistent indoor climate, reducing the need for excessive heating or cooling.

3.1 The Impact of Asphalt on Temperature Regulation
Asphalt surfaces have a significant impact on the thermal environment around homes. Dark asphalt absorbs more sunlight, contributing to the heat island effect. By choosing reflective or cooler asphalt alternatives, local commercial asphalt contractors can aid in reducing ambient temperatures.

9.1 Strategic Tree Planting for Energy Savings
Local tree service contractors are pivotal in designing tree placements that naturally regulate a home’s climate. Strategic planting provides shade, reducing air conditioning demands in summer while acting as windbreaks during colder months. Properly planned tree arrangements yield energy savings year-round.
